For first-time buyers here, exploring California-specific and local assistance programs is a non-negotiable step. The California Housing Finance Agency (CalHFA) offers several flagship programs, like the MyHome Assistance Program, which provides deferred-payment loans for down payment and closing costs. Many of these programs have income limits that are adjusted by county, making them accessible for qualifying buyers in our area. A knowledgeable mortgage lender will be well-versed in these programs and can seamlessly integrate them with a conventional FHA or VA loan.
Your actionable search should start with a mix of local and national options. Don't overlook smaller, local credit unions like SchoolsFirst FCU or credit unions based in the San Gabriel Valley. They often have a deep community focus and may offer favorable terms. Simultaneously, consult with established mortgage brokers who have relationships with multiple wholesale lenders and can shop rates on your behalf. Always ask any lender you interview: "What is your experience helping first-time buyers in Los Angeles County close on homes, particularly in competitive situations?"
Finally, get pre-approved, not just pre-qualified. In the City Of Industry area, a strong pre-approval letter from a reputable lender is your ticket to having your offer taken seriously. This document shows sellers you are a credible and prepared buyer.
